NeuroVive resolves on rights issue totaling approximately SEK 94.4 million for continued development of the project portfolio


On 28 February 2016, The Board of Directors of NeuroVive Pharmaceutical AB
(publ) (“NeuroVive” or ”the Company”) decided to carry out a new issue of shares
and warrants (units) with preferential rights for existing shareholders (the
“New Issue”). The resolution is subject to approval by the forthcoming
Extraordinary General Meeting. Upon full subscription of the New Issue, the
Company will raise approximately SEK 94.4 m before issue expenses. Full exercise
of the warrants will raise at least a further SEK 32.6 million for the Company.
The proceeds from the New Issue will be used for NeuroVive’s continued
operations in drug development, clinical trials and partnership activities.
The New Issue is conditional on the approval of the Extraordinary General
Meeting on 31 March 2016. For more information, please refer to a separate press
release on the notice convening the Extraordinary General Meeting.

The New Issue in summary:

  · NeuroVive’s shareholders have preferential rights to subscribe for 1 unit
consisting of 8 new shares, one (1) free-of-charge warrant of series 2016/2017:1
and one (1) free-of-charge warrant of series 2016/2017:2, for each 14 existing
shares held on the record date of 8 April 2016.
  · The subscription price is SEK 42 per unit, corresponding to SEK 5.25 per
share.
  · Upon full subscription of the New Issue, NeuroVive will raise approximately
SEK 94.4 million before issue expenses.
  · Upon full utilization of the warrants, NeuroVive will raise a minimum of a
further SEK 32.6 million before issue expenses.
  · The subscription period is 18 April – 2 May 2016.
  · 75% of the New Issue is guaranteed through guarantee commitments.

Background

NeuroVive conducts research and development aimed at generating candidate drugs
for mitochondrial protection, as well as developing pharmaceuticals in other
areas where cyclophilin inhibitors or changes in mitochondrial energy production
are central mechanisms. The project portfolio consists of two projects for acute
kidney injury (AKI) and traumatic brain injury (TBI) - both can potentially
satisfy significant medical needs - with three drug candidates in clinical and
pre-clinical development. In addition, the portfolio contains two platforms
focusing on ischemic stroke and hereditary mitochondrial disorders.

In June 2015, NeuroVive announced the topline results from the external Phase
III study (CIRCUS) which evaluated the effects of administering CicloMulsion® in
patients undergoing perc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) after a specific
type of acute myocardial infarction (STEMI). The study did not show any
therapeutic effect in this patient group. Accordingly, NeuroVive decided to
terminate the development of CicloMulsion® for the indication acute myocardial
infarction in August. The reason for the negative results is thought to be an
unexpectedly short treatment window for myocardial infarction, which means that
CicloMulsion® would not have reached its intended target in time to have a
therapeutic effect on the heart injury. However, the CIRCUS study provided
NeuroVive with new and valuable understanding of the indications where
CicloMulsion® can be effective, which led to a strategic refocus towards acute
kidney injury for CicloMulsion®. NeuroVive assesses that this new strategic
direction differs materially as pre-treatment with CicloMulsion® means that
mitochondrial protection is in place before potential kidney injury arises. In
2015, an investor-initiated clinical Phase II study (CiPRICS) in pre-operative
treatment was started in patients undergoing coronary heart surgery. The study
will include a total of 150 patients and is expected to conclude in the second
half of 2016. Given a positive outcome, a complementary smaller Phase II study
will then be initiated.

The Company is currently conducting a further Phase II study (CHIC) which
evaluates the drug candidate NeuroSTAT® in traumatic brain injury. Last year, an
independent safety committee concluded that NeuroSTAT® is safe to use at the
doses administered in the first dosage group and recommended that the study
continue at the next dose level as planned. In November 2015, NeuroVive
introduced strategic measures aimed at increasing the recruitment rate. These
measures have been successful so far, and the Company estimates that the study
will reach planned patient numbers and conclude towards the end of the year.

NeuroVive is also working on an additional project, NVP019, which is currently
in the pre-clinical phase and has the potential to become the next generation
cyclophilin inhibitor focusing on acute kidney injury, and the two development
platforms for ischemic stroke and hereditary mitochondrial disorders (Complex I
Deficiency) respectively.

As part of the Company’s strategy to complement in-house research with
collaborations alongside pharmaceutical companies and academic institutions,
NeuroVive acquired a stake in the UK company Isomerase Therapeutics in January
2016. Part of the payment was made in newly issued shares in NeuroVive, with the
aim of strengthening the collaboration and ensuring that NeuroVive’s development
projects remain a top priority for Isomerase.

NeuroVive’s main aim is to complete the ongoing Phase II CiPRICS and CHIC
studies before the end of 2016, and to complete a smaller follow-up study for
these projects in spring 2017. Subsequently, NeuroVive plans to outlicense
CicloMulsion® and NeuroSTAT® or otherwise enter into partnerships that will
cover ongoing development costs and bring the product to the market. This would
usually generate revenue in the form of upfront payments on outlicensing and
milestone payments on the way to launch, as well as royalty based on sales.
Outlicensing projects and collaborations with large pharmaceutical companies is
central to NeuroVive’s business model and the Company’s long-term strategy of
achieving risk-reduced and cost-effective development and commercialization of
its products.

The main motivation for the SEK 94.4 million New Issue before issue expenses is
to raise capital to bring CicloMulsion® for acute kidney injury and NeuroSTAT®
for traumatic brain injury through clinical Phase II studies to licensing, and
to complete pre-clinical studies in NVP019. A smaller proportion of the proceeds
will be used for activities related to the Company’s development platforms and
for the development of the patent portfolio and the Company’s ongoing expenses.
The Company assesses that, before the completion of the New Issue, NeuroVive’s
working capital for the next twelve months is insufficient to implement the
Company’s business plan, but that NeuroVive’s working capital requirement will
be satisfied by the New Issue. In the event that the New Issue is not fully
subscribed, the Company will step down its activities relating to the two
development platforms and focus primarily on the Company’s program for acute
kidney injury and traumatic brain injury. The Company assesses that the
guarantee commitments for the amount of SEK 70.85 million, corresponding to 75%
of the New Issue, is sufficient to satisfy the working capital requirement for
the coming twelve months given such a scenario.

Terms and Conditions governing the New Issue

One (1) existing share in the Company entitles to one (1) unit right. Fourteen
(14) unit rights entitle to subscription of one (1) unit, consisting of eight
(8) new shares, one (1) warrant of series 2016/2017:1 and one (1) warrant of
series 2016/2017:2.

The subscription price per unit is SEK 42, corresponding to a subscription price
of SEK 5.25 per share. The warrants are issued without consideration.

One (1) warrant of series 2016/2017:1 entitles to subscription of one (1) share
in the Company at a subscription price of SEK 6.50. Subscription for shares in
the Company on the basis of warrants of series 2016/2017:1 may take place during
the period from and including 2 January 2017 up to and including 28 February
2017.

One (1) warrant of series 2016/2017:2 entitles to subscription for one (1) share
in the Company at a subscription price of 70% of the Company’s volume-weighted
average share price on Nasdaq Stockholm over 15 trading days before the
beginning of the subscription period, subject to a minimum of SEK 8.
Subscription for shares in the Company on the basis of warrants of series
2016/2017:2 may take place during the period from and including 1 June 2017 up
to and including 30 June 2017.

Guarantee providers

The Rights Issue is guaranteed up to an amount of approximately SEK 70.9
million, corresponding to 75% of the New Issue, through guarantee commitments
with external investors. Cash commission of ten per cent (10%) of the guaranteed
amount is payable under the guarantee commitments. No cash funds or other assets
have been pledged and no other security has been issued to secure the
commitments. More information regarding the parties providing guarantee
commitments will be published in the prospectus which is scheduled for
publication in accordance with the above preliminary schedule on 12 April 2016.

Share structure and share capital

The Board of Directors has resolved to, subject to approval by the General
Meeting, increase the Company’s share capital by no more than SEK 899,248
through an issue of no more than 17,984,960 new shares.

Furthermore, the Board of Directors has resolved to, subject to approval by the
General Meeting, issue no more than 2,248,120 warrants of series 2016/2017:1,
entitling to subscription of no more than 2,248,120 shares in the Company, and
no more than 2,248,120 warrants of series 2016/2017:2, entitling to subscription
of no more than 2,248,120 shares in the Company, whereby the Company’s share
capital may, upon exercise of the warrants of series 2016/2017:1 and
2016/2017:2, increase by no more than SEK 224,812.

Existing shareholders not participating in the New Issue will be subject to a
dilution effect, provided the New Issue is fully subscribed and given full
utilization of the warrants, of 41.7%.
